Advertisement
npsoni

rust-input

Apr 15th, 2021
1,627
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Rust 0.43 KB | None | 0 0
  1. fn main() {
  2.     println!("Entere a number");
  3.     // let n: i64 = get_input().trim().parse().unwrap();
  4.     let n: i64 = match get_input().trim().parse() {
  5.         Ok(num) => num,
  6.         Err(_) => continue,
  7.     };
  8.     println!("You entered {}", n);
  9. }
  10.  
  11.  
  12. // input function
  13. fn get_input() -> String {
  14.     let mut buffer = String::new();
  15.     std::io::stdin().read_line(&mut buffer).expect("Couldn't read from input");
  16.     buffer
  17.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ement